Kinds Of Bunk Beds for TeensWhen it comes to selecting a bunk bed for teens, the choices are huge. Here's a comprehensive overview of the numerous types offered:

Type of Bunk Bed Description

Standard Bunk Bed Makes up two twin beds stacked one on top of the other. Perfect for maximizing sleeping space.

Loft Bed Functions a raised top bed with the lower space exposed for a desk, couch, or extra storage. Perfect for studying and producing a comfortable hangout space.

Futon Bunk Bed Features a twin bed on top and a futon on the bottom, enabling flexible usage as seating during the day and sleeping during the night.

Twin over Full Bunk Bed Uses a twin bed on the leading and a complete bed on the bottom, accommodating various sleeping plans for pals and siblings.

Triple Bunk Bed Created for 3 sleepers, this type can be particularly effective in brother or sisters' spaces or throughout slumber parties.

Custom Bunk Bed Designs Customized choices can include built-in racks, desks, and even themed styles, enabling customization that shows a teen's style.
